TCAHA offers competitive Rep hockey for youth ages 9 to 18. The winter season Rep programs offer competitive hockey at a higher level than House hockey.  The program requires more practice time, higher ice costs, and more out-of-town travel than House.  The costs listed are for registration only and are mandatory for all players. Additional expenses are required for equipment, uniforms, extra ice, travel, etc., depending on each team's decisions.

A tryout fee in the amount of $100.00 for each player who attends must be paid or the player must register with TCAHA prior to attending any try-outs(s) will be charged.  All Registered players in each division shall be eligible to attend Rep team tryouts for their natural age division. Players wishing to play on any full time rep team throughout the season are required to attend the first tryout of the top-tiered team. The only way to maintain eligibility for a full time rep team without attending the first team tryout for the respective age division is to have written permission from that age division’s top tiered coach. This means if you cannot attend the first tryout, you must contact the highest tiered coach and registrar and get their approval. A supplemental tryout may be held, throughout the season, at the request of the highest tiered coach in a division.

The Squirt age division is an intermediate level where younger players begin to expand on their individual skills and team play. While Squirts are larger and more skilled than the younger Mite players, its still an age where the primary focus is on fundamentals and enjoyment.

The Pee Wee age division is a significant transition for an up and coming youth hockey player. No longer are they restricted from body checking and slap shots. Therefore, practice sessions (especially pre-season) are heavily focused on learning to give and receive a check, as well as the skill of shooting slap shots.

Bantam age players are developing physically into adulthood, resulting in a more physical and spirited approach to the game of hockey. While hockey fundamentals are stressed at all ages, the needs of Bantam players, both on and off the ice are somewhat different than they were at the younger age divisions. Sportsmanship, team play, and skill development are stressed, while enjoyment of the game is recognized as a key component to keeping
players involved in youth hockey through the teenage years.

While Bantam age players are still growing, Midgets have reached adulthood physically (size and strength). Midget age players often have jobs, cars, girl friends, boy friends, and increased scholastic demands. At times, fitting hockey into their busy schedules can be difficult. These factors are taken into account when scheduling and planning our Midget program.
